Solucionario Diseño de Concreto Reforzado McCormac 10ma Edición
is a comprehensive educational resource providing step-by-step solutions to all end-of-chapter problems in the textbook by Jack C. McCormac and Russell H. Brown. This edition is updated to align with the ACI 318-14 building code. Key Features of the 10th Edition Solution Manual Comprehensive Coverage
: Includes detailed solutions for all 20 chapters of the textbook, covering basic fundamentals to advanced structural elements. Code Compliance
: Specifically designed to match the requirements and formulas of the ACI 318-14 (American Concrete Institute) regulations. Step-by-Step Methodology
: Provides the derivation of beam expressions, load combinations, and clear mathematical walkthroughs for complex engineering problems. Dual Units : Solutions often feature both U.S. Customary SI (International System) units to accommodate global engineering standards. Digital Integration
